I've been experimenting with various superfoods. After 3 plus years raw I thought I should see what the fuss is all about.
So I love the algaes, and a couple of other things which have made me feel great. But then there's Maca...now I always thought that should be The One for me because I used to have a hormone inbalance which has been healing since I went raw, and I know maca's supposed to be great for that. So I tried it, I put it in some orange juice and just chugged it down, I retched straight away, but I managed to keep it down. Then after a couple of hours of what felt like sea sickness I threw up violently everywhere. This was hours ago and I still feel pretty rotten.
Has anyone else had this kind of reaction with maca? I had 2 tablespoons of organic maca whch I got off Shazzie's website.

Yeah I think you started with a huge dosage. I have started out small, couple teaspoons and then increase.
I've never had a negative reaction and I've taken up to a tablespoon at a time in my smoothies, usually half a tablespoon. Can't imagine taking it with orange juice.
Here's my favorite recipe:
1 Thai young coconut with coconut water, a cup of almond milk, 2 T. raw cacao, 1/2 T. maca, 1/4 t. cinnamon, 2 or 3 T. agave nectar, a cup of cold water or more and half a dozen ice cubes. It has the thicknes and taste reminicent of a chocolate malt to me when less water is used.
